Supreme Court Hears LGBTQ Work Discrimination Case

The Brian Lehrer Show | Apr 23, 2019

The Supreme Court agreed to hear two LGBTQ workplace discrimination cases. Gabriel Arkles, senior staff attorney at the ACLU, talks about the significance of these cases and specifically the case of Aimee Stephens, a transgender woman who was fired when her employer learned she was trans.
